The following taps are not trusted:
aws/tap
azure/bicep
Homebrew will ignore formulae, casks and commands from these taps when `HOMEBREW_REQUIRE_TAP_TRUST` is set.
This will become the default in Homebrew 6.0.0 or 5.2.0, whichever comes first.
Enable trust checks now with:
export HOMEBREW_REQUIRE_TAP_TRUST=1
Trust specific formulae, casks or commands with:
brew trust --formula <user>/<tap>/<formula>
brew trust --cask <user>/<tap>/<cask>
brew trust --command <user>/<tap>/<command>
or trust installed formulae from these taps with:
brew trust --formula azure/bicep/bicep
You can trust all formulae, casks and commands from these taps with:
brew trust aws/tap azure/bicep
Prefer trusting only the specific formulae, casks or commands you need.
Untap them with:
brew untap aws/tap azure/bicep
To keep allowing them by default during the transition:
export HOMEBREW_NO_REQUIRE_TAP_TRUST=1
This is not recommended and will be removed in a later release.
